So, last time we talked about High quality Rating and every thing that this involves. You can learn it here. Now let’s think about the way of deceiving the interfaces extra intently to raised understand how antidetect apps work.

Canvas is an HTML5 API which is used to draw graphics and animations on an online page through scripting in JavaScript. JS-scripts offers the parameters of a picture and browser, using sources of a device, renders the image. The purpose is that the same canvas picture could also be rendered otherwise in numerous computers. It might depend upon the working programs, model of a browser, installed libraries, video playing cards’ drivers, graphical adapters, etc.

This is the second when you should meet such a factor as uniqueness score. This rating reveals how many devices have the same hash print as yours. The extra devices have the same print, the lower your uniqueness score. For instance, if 5000 devices have the same hash print per every 100.000 devices then they are distinctive by ninety five%. The lower this determine, the better. Is it clear? Good, moving on.

Canvas print knowledge are enough to determine the user’s uniqueness with a determine increased than ninety five%. “Apple” customers are doing better. Apple devices are often customized and their uniqueness is lower by default. That’s the reason Google and Facebook farmers have a tendency to use their outdated MacBook for their soiled practices.

Until just lately, antidetect services have been dealing with Canvas fingerprinting by altering the pixel colour attributes. Even small modifications are enough to vary the hash print. Nonetheless, this method has its shortcomings. Of course, hash modifications and Facebook can’t discover a connection between your system and different blocked profiles. However your uniqueness score shall be one hundred% (or almost so). At finest, your print will coincide with the prints of different customers of the same antidetect Browser. However this is not going to assist much. It’s like wear a Batman mask and walk around town. Of course, nobody will see your actual face but everybody will have a look at you like you’re an idiot.

Furthermore, Facebook can match the desired rendering parameters and the method of rendering different photos within the browser and, thus, can discover a forgery of hash print. So Facebook will understand that you are a user of an antidetect service. And it gained’t bode well.

WebGL is JavaScript API, it makes use of greater than 300 simple primitive capabilities for rendering extra complicated 3D photos with the OpenGL library. You will get a unique number of the metadata parameters relying on the video card. The exams say that due to JS, Facebook receives only these parameters which are needed to render a picture correctly on a device. There is no complete WebGL fingerprinting process. But it doesn’t imply that different services (that Facebook makes use of) don’t as well.

Altering print is carried out by altering the transparency of colors. Sadly, you will discover any public WebGL print knowledge for comparison. However we can assume that the distinctiveness of such modified print shall be almost one hundred% as well. Furthermore, WebGL and Canvas can literally check each other because complicated 3D photos consist of extra simple 2D images. The difference between Canvas and WebGL rendering makes Facebook one hundred% positive that anyone wears a Batman mask.

WebRTC is a browser commonplace which permits customers to make audio and video calls proper within the browser, without using another software. Very useful but not so safe. A website can get the information about an audio adapter and all of the audio devices like webcam, microphone, speakers. Nonetheless, the devices’ producers provide them with hash identification. So, Facebook knows not just concerning the existence of a device but it knows their ID as well. Also, the browser leaks your native and public IP-addresses (bypassing VPN, of course).

Seems like every particular person in the best mind should flip WebRTC off once and forever. However! Disabled WebRTC is a wake-up call for each antifraud system because normal customers don’t flip it off so this will likely add you just a few percents of uniqueness.

Antidetect of the system can change each native and public IP-addresses within the WebRTC interface but you may’t make audio and video calls anymore (using your browser, of course). Yow will discover extra information about WebRTC right here:

Fonts. By measuring the dimensions of the textual content in HTML, overlaying texts on each other and different strategies, the antifraud programs can recognize the list of the installed fonts within the system. Some strategies power the browser to use the installed libraries to show texts. Depending on the working system (GDI and DirectWrite for Windows, Core Textual content for MacOS and Pango for Linux), the libraries behave otherwise and it creates some additional opportunities to determine the user’s system even using the emulators and anti-detect programs.

Modernizr – is a js-library that permits you to determine 290 options of a browser in a moment. The factor is that the set of those options may range in numerous versions of a browser. Most individuals have an auto-update browser. So, using the early versions of Chrome and FireFox will increase your uniqueness score, which is not good.

Happily (for us), anti-detect services at all times update the content of their browsers to the current versions of Mozilla Firefox and Chrome.

Facebook doesn’t rely only on gathering and analyzing the data. Its main power is in dynamics, give attention to analyzing the behavior of customers and optimizing algorithms. That’s the reason using equivalent consumables and typical schemes at all times result in tighter control. WebGL metadata and Modernizr content (every print of two billion customers) storage is extremely powerful technology. In flip, there’s a international behavioral knowledge-base already. They’re used within the anti-fraud service of Facebook

Right and careful use of identification protection services may be the idea for successful work. So what’s the deal if you can run black-hat campaigns and scale up if you can’t even launch lead sort adverts?

That’s it for today. Next time we’ll speak about antidetect services and how do they work. Keep tuned